Responsibilities
- Provide compassionate care and assistance to individuals in a group home setting, ensuring their daily needs are met.
- Assist with activities of daily living (ADLs), including personal hygiene, meal preparation, and medication reminders.
- Observe and document patient behavior and health status, reporting any changes to the appropriate personnel.
- Maintain a clean and safe living environment, adhering to health and safety standards.
- Communicate effectively with residents and their families to foster a supportive community.
